FC Stellenbosch – Mamelodi Sundowns, score 0-1, was the last match in the South African championship. The match took place on March 11, at 19:30, the author of the goal being Themba Zwane, in the 9th minute. The threat of a pandemic became real, so it was decided that all matches should be postponed. At the moment the leader of the Premier League is Kaizer Chiefs, team that in the previous season ranked 9th, having 39 points in 30 stages. Now, the team coached by the German Ernst Middendorp is in first place in the standings, with 48 points after 22 stages. “Amakhosi” have the most wins, 15 in number, but also the best attack, scoring 40 goals. Kaizer Chiefs won the last title in the 2012-2013 season. Champion Mamelodi Sundowns has 44 points and is 2nd in the standings, but has a less contested match and can come to 1 point leader. The team coached by Pitso Mosimane has the best defense in the championship, scoring only 15 goals in 21 stages. It should be noted that “The Brazilians” have won the last two Premier League titles and will try to “triple”. The teams ranked 3rd and 4th, SuperSport United and Orlando Pirates have 40 points, but they have little chance of winning the competition, because they have 24 stages, respectively 23 and already the distance to Kaizer Chiefs is 8 points. Kaizer Chiefs will play at home with Mamelodi Sundowns

In the last 6 matches this season, Kaizer Chiefs will play with Bloemfontein Celtic (9th place, away), FC Stellenbosch (11th place, home), Mamelodi Sundowns (2nd place, home), Bidvest Wits (6th place, away), Chippa United (12th place at home) and FC Baroka (13th place, away), while Mamelodi Sundowns will meet them in the last 7 games (Maritzburg United 5th place, away), Cape Town City (10th place, away), Golden Arrows (7th place, home), Kaizer Chiefs (1st place, away), FC Baroka (13th place, home), Polokwane City (14th place, away) and Black Leopards (16th place, home). Therefore, the match that can decide the title will be played at the “FNB” stadium in Johannesburg, and Kaizer Chiefs will have the advantage of his own field and the support of tens of thousands of fans. In the round, on October 27, 2019, Mamelodi Sundowns lost 0-2 at home to Kaizer Chiefs, the 2 goals being scored by Serbian striker Samir Nurković in the 7th and 78th minutes.

Nurković and Zwane, the goalkeepers of both teams

Kaizer Chiefs scorers are Serb Samir Nurković (11 goals), Colombian Leonardo Castro (7 goals) and Lebogang Manyama (6 goals), the latter having the most goals, 8. The top scorers at Mamelodi Sundowns are Themba Zwane (9 goals) and Sibusiso Vilakazi (5 goals), the last one having the most assists, 8. For “Bafana baStyle” the delay of the matches was good, because Thapelo Morena, Oupa Manyisa, Lucky Mohomi, Anthony Laffor and Mauricio Affonso are injured, while “Glamor Boys” do not have players with medical problems.
